全国计算机等级考试二级
问答题在考生目录下有一个工程文件sjr5.vbp,用来计算勾股定理整数组合的个数。勾股定理中3个数的关系式是a2+b2=c2。例如,3,4,5就是一个满足条件的整数组合(注意:a,b,c分别为4,3,5与分别为3,4,5被视为同一个组合,不应该重复计算)。编写程序,统计三个数均在60以内满足上述关系的整数组合的个数,并显示在标签Label1中。 注意:不得修改原有程序的控件的属性。在结束程序运行之前,必须至少正确运行一次程序,将统计的结果显示在标签中,否则无成绩。最后把修改后的文件按源文件名存盘。
问答题(1)在考生文件夹下有一个工程文件sjt3.vbp。其窗体文件上有一个标题为“得分”的框架,在框架中有一个名称为Text1的文本框数组,含6个文本框控件;文本框Text2用来输入难度系数。程序运行时,在左边的6个文本框中输入6个得分,输入难度系数后,单击“计算分数”按钮,则可计算出最后得分并显示在文本框Text3中(如下图所示)。 程序提供代码 计算方法: 去掉1个最高得分和1个最低得分,求剩下得分的平均分,再乘以3,再乘以难度系数。最后结果保留到第2位小数,不四舍五入。 注意:文件中已经给出了所有控件和程序,但程序不完整,请去掉程序中的注释符,把程序中的“?”改为正确的内容,考生不能修改程序中的其他部分和各控件的属性。最后把修改后的文件按原文件名存盘。 (2)在考生文件夹下有一个工程文件sjt4.bp。程序运行时,若选中“累加”单选按钮,则“10”、“12”菜单项不可用,若选中“阶乘”单选按钮,则“1000”“2000”菜单项不可用(如下图所示)。选中菜单中的一个菜单项后,单击“计算”按钮,则相应的计算结果在文本框中显示(例如,选中“累加”和“2000”,则计算1+2+3…+2000,选中“阶乘”和“10”,则计算10!)。单击“存盘”按钮则把文本框中的结果保存到考生文件夹下的out4.dat文件中。 要求:编写“计算”按钮的Click事件过程。 注意:不得修改已经存在的程序,在结束程序运行之前,必须用“存盘”按钮存储计算结果,否则无成绩。最后。程序按原文件名存盘。
问答题(1)在考生目录下有一个工程文件sjt3.vbp。窗体上有个钟表图案,其中代表指针的直线的名称是Line1,还有一个名称为Label1的标签和其他一些控件(如图1所示)。在运行时,若用鼠标左键单击圆的边线,则指针指向鼠标单击的位置(如图2所示);若用鼠标右键单击圆的边线,则指针恢复到起始位置(如图1所示);若鼠标左键或右键单击其他位置,则在标签上显示“鼠标位置不对”。文件中已经给出了所有控件和程序,但程序不完整,请去掉程序中的注释符,把程序中的?改为正确的内容。程序中的oncircle函数的作用是判断鼠标单击的位置是否在圆的边线上(判断结果略有误差),是则返回True,否则返回False。符号常量x0、y0是圆心距窗体左上角的距离;符号常量radius是圆的半径。 注意:不能修改程序中的其他部分和各控件的属性。最后把修改后的文件按原文件名存盘。图1图2 (2)在考生目录下有一个工程文件sjt4.vbp,窗体如图3所示。其功能是单击“输入数据”按钮,则可输入一个整数n(8<=n<=12);单击“计算”按钮,则计算1!+2!+3!+…+n!,并将计算结果显示在文本框中;单击“存盘”按钮,则把文本框中的结果保存到考生目录下的out4.dat文件中。文件中已经给出了所有控件和程序,但程序不完整,请去掉程序中的注释符,把程序中的?改为正确的内容,并编写“计算”按钮的Click事件过程。 注意:不得修改已经存在的内容和控件属性,在结束程序运行之前,必须用“存盘”按钮存储计算结果,否则无成绩。最后把修改后的文件按原文件名存盘。图3
单选题软件(程序)调试的任务是( )。
单选题在软件设计中,不属于过程设计工具的是( )。
单选题下面属于应用软件的是( )。
单选题为了从当前文件夹中读入文件File1.txt,某人编写了下面的程序: 程序: 程序调试时,发现有错误,下面的修改方案中正确的是( )。
单选题向顺序文件Temp.txt中写入1,2,3这3个数。在程序中加入( )可以使程序功能完整。
单选题在窗体上画一个名称为Command1的命令按钮,并编写如下程序: 运行程序,单击命令按钮,其输出结果为( )。
单选题下列关于软件测试的目的和准则的叙述中,正确的是( )。
单选题下面不能作为软件需求分析工具的是( )。
单选题在软件开发中,需求分析阶段产生的主要文档是( )。
问答题(1)在考生文件夹下游一个工程文件sjt3.vbp。窗体上有名称为Timer1的定时器,以及名称为Line1和Line2的两条水平直线。请用名称为Shape1的形状控件,在两条直线之间画一个宽和高都相等的形状,其显示形式为圆,并设置适当属性使其满足以下要求:①圆的顶端距窗体Form1顶端的距离为360;②圆的颜色为红色(红色对应的值为:&H000000FF&或&HFF&),如图所示。程序运行时,Shape1将在Line1和Line2之间运动。当Shape1的顶端到达Line1时,会自动改变方向而向下运动;当Shape1的底部到达Line2时,会改变方向而向上运动。文件中给出的程序不完整,请去掉程序中的注释符,把程序中的?改正确内容,使其实现上述功能 注意:不能修改程序的其他部分和已给出控件的属性。最后将修改后的文件按原文件名存盘。 (2)在考生文件夹下有一个工程文件sjt4.vbp,包含了所有控件和部分程序,如图所示。程序功能如下:①单击“读数据”按钮,可将考生文件夹下in4.dat文件中的100个整数读到数组a中;②单击“计算”按钮,可根据从名称为Combol的组合框中选中的项目,对数组a中的数据计算平均值,并将计算结果四舍五入取整后显示在文本框Text1中。“读数据”按钮的Click事件过程已经给出,请为“计算”按钮编写适当的事件过程以实现上述功能。 注意:不得修改已经存在的控件和程序,在结束程序运行之前,必须进行一次计算,且必须用窗体右上角的关闭按钮结束程序,否则无成绩。最后,程序按原文件名存盘。
问答题请根据以下各小题的要求设计Visual Basic应用程序(包括界面和代码)。 (1)在名称为Form1、“标题”的窗体上画一个名称为Label1的标签,并设置适当属性以满足以下要求:①标签的内容为“计算机等级考试”;②标签可根据显示内容自动调整其大小;③标签带有边框、且标签内容现实为三号字。运行后的窗体如图所示。 注意:存盘时必须存放在考生文件夹下,工程文件名为sjt1.vbp,窗体问件名为sjt1.frm。 (2)在名称为Form1的窗体上画一个名称为Hscroll1的水平滚动条,其刻度范围为1~100;再画一个名称为Text1的文本框,初始内容为1。程序开始运行时,焦点在滚动条上。请编写适当的事件过程,使得程序运行时,文本框中实时显示滚动框的当前位置。运行情况如图所示。 注意:要求程序中不得使用变量,每个事件过程中只能写一条语句。存盘时必须存放在考生文件夹下,工程文件名为sjt2.vbp,窗体文件名为sjt2.frm。
问答题(1)在考生文件夹下有一个工程文件stj3.vbp。窗体上有三个文本框Text1、Text2、Text3,其中Text3可以多行显示,并已经输入了内容(如图所示),Text1用来输入要查找的内容,Text2用来输入要替换的内容。程序运行时,在Text1、Text2中输入文字,单击“替换”按钮,则在Text3中找到Text1中的内容,并用Text2中的内容替换,若未找到,则不替换。此外窗体上还有两个单选按钮,名称依次为Option1、Option2,标题依次为“第一个”“全部”。程序运行后若Option1被选中,则只替换Text3中第一个匹配的字符串,若Option2被选中,则替换text3中所有匹配的字符串。在窗体文件中已经给出了全部的控件,但程序不完整,要求去掉程序中的注释符.把程序中的“?”改为正确的内容。加下图所示。 试题源程序: (2)在考生文件夹下有一个工程文件T316.vbp,窗体上已给出所有控件,如下图所示。在text1文本框中输入一个任意的字符串(要求串的长度≥10),然后选择组合框中的三个截取运算选项之一。单击“计算”按钮,将截取运算后的结果显示在text2中。 窗体文件中已经给出了程序,但不完整,请去掉程序中的注释符,把程序中的“?”处改为正确的内容。 试题源程序:
单选题下列工具中,不属于结构化分析的常用工具的是( )。
单选题下面对软件测试和软件调试有关概念叙述错误的是( )。
单选题需求分析阶段的任务是( )。
单选题窗体上有一个名称为Command1的命令按钮,其事件过程如下: 关于上述程序,以下叙述中错误的是( )。
单选题假定用下面的语句打开文件: 则不能正确读文件的语句是( )。
当前列表仅展示前20条试题,搜“题王”小程序查看更多考题~